Section 318-B:31 - Definitions.

    318-B:31 Definitions. – In this subdivision:
    I. "Board'' means the pharmacy board, established in RSA 318:2.
    II. "Controlled substance'' means controlled drugs as defined in RSA 318-B:1, VI.
    III. "Dispense'' means to deliver a controlled substance by lawful means and includes the packaging, labeling, or compounding necessary to prepare the substance for such delivery.
    IV. "Dispenser'' means a person who is lawfully authorized to deliver a schedule II-IV controlled substance, but does not include:
       (a) A licensed hospital pharmacy that dispenses for administration in the hospital;
       (b) A practitioner, or other authorized person who administers such a substance; or
       (c) A wholesale distributor of a schedule II-IV controlled substance or its analog.
    V. "Patient'' means the person or animal who is the ultimate user of a controlled substance for whom a lawful prescription is issued and for whom a controlled substance or other such drug is lawfully dispensed.
    VI. "Practitioner'' means a physician, dentist, podiatrist, veterinarian, or other person licensed or otherwise permitted to prescribe, dispense, or administer a controlled substance in the course of licensed professional practice.
    VII. "Prescribe'' means to issue a direction or authorization, by prescription, permitting a patient to lawfully obtain controlled substances.
    VIII. "Prescriber''means a practitioner or other authorized person who prescribes a schedule II, III, and/or IV controlled substance.
    IX. "Program'' means the controlled drug prescription health and safety program that electronically facilitates the confidential sharing of information relating to the prescribing and dispensing of controlled substances listed in schedules II-IV, established by the board pursuant to RSA 318-B:32.

Source. 2012, 196:2, eff. June 12, 2012.
